The Avery Trial: Episode 21 - Touching Evidence? No Problem.

In this episode of Beach House 34, we hear the testimony of William Brandes, a volunteer firefighter who discovered Teresa Halbach’s missing license plates, and Trooper Cindy Paine, who confirmed that they were in fact, Teresa's plates.

Brandes admits to picking up the plates, which were folded. Then he unfolded them and read the number —before law enforcement secured the scene. He was wearing his own personal gloves, not department-issued ones, which matters. Meanwhile, law enforcement stood by and let it happen. No objection. No intervention.

What’s even more shocking? The defense barely pushed back when it came for their time to question him. And when it was the defense's turn to question Paine? They didn't ask her one.single.question.

How does that happen in a high-profile murder trial?
